Why graduate studies at StFX?
Graduate students can excel in an intimate, primarily undergraduate university setting. Graduate students enhance the StFX academic programs and contribute significantly to teaching, student mentorship, and research excellence. Our graduate students have gone on to stellar research careers and work in a variety of organizations.
In deciding to pursue graduate work at StFX, you join a network of other students and alumni from around the world who have committed to the pursuit of academic excellence in a personalized and collegial environment.
Program options
St. Francis Xavier University currently offers courses of study leading to graduate degrees in Arts, Science and Education. The StFX graduate student experience is a unique one, characterized by an opportunity to develop leadership skills, to interact with colleagues and faculty in a peer-to-peer setting, and to benefit from the kind of personal attention and camaraderie for which StFX is famous.
